Understand Italy’s Import Rules

Before you send electronics abroad, check Italy’s import requirements. Devices that include lithium batteries — such as phones, tablets, and cameras — must be declared properly. Batteries should be removed when possible or packed according to international air-safety standards.

Customs may also require an invoice or a short product description. For personal shipments, use the note “used electronic item for personal use.” For new items or business deliveries, attach a receipt or proof of purchase to avoid unnecessary inspections.

How to Pack Electronics Correctly

Good packaging protects your devices during transit and helps prevent damage. Poorly packed parcels are more likely to be delayed or damaged during inspection. Meest-America recommends following these steps for safe and efficient packing:

  1. Use a sturdy double-wall cardboard box that can handle long-distance travel.
  2. Wrap each device carefully with bubble wrap or soft foam to absorb shocks.
  3. Place accessories like chargers and cables in small sealed bags to keep them organized.
  4. Fill empty spaces with paper or air cushions to prevent items from shifting.
  5. Seal the box securely with strong tape and label it clearly.

Once the package is sealed, double-check that all items inside are stable and cannot move during transit.

Prepare Your Documentation

When sending electronics abroad, include a customs declaration form CN23 and a return address that matches your online order. Using the Meest portal makes this step easy — the platform automatically generates the necessary forms as you complete your shipment online.

Accurate paperwork speeds up customs clearance and prevents your package from getting stuck in review. Always provide a clear description of what’s inside and its approximate value in U.S. dollars. If you’re sending multiple items, specify each product on the form. Keep copies of all documents in case you need to contact support or verify shipment details later.

Items You Can’t Ship to Italy

Italy restricts certain electronic goods for safety or regulatory reasons. It’s essential to know what is not allowed before sending your package. The following items are prohibited:

  • high-capacity power banks or non-removable lithium batteries;
  • drones with transmitters or cameras that require import licenses;
  • electronic cigarettes or vaping devices;
  • counterfeit or replica technology products.

Final Tips for Smooth Delivery

International delivery doesn’t have to be complicated. Double-check the recipient’s full address, including postal code, and make sure all contact details are correct. Avoid shipping right before major holidays or during national strikes, when customs offices are overloaded.

Use Meest’s online tracking system to monitor your parcel in real time from pickup to delivery. Most shipments from the U.S. to Italy arrive in about 7–14 business days, depending on location and service type.
